Top 10 List of Week 09

  1. Magnetic Disk
    This page discusses types of disk storage from the oldest to the most recent. Magnetic disk is a type of secondary memory which is a flat disk covered with a magnetic layer to store a lot of information. It is used to store various programs and files.

  3. Magnetic Tape Memory
    Magnetic Tape is mainly used for backups. Back then, it was used for regular secondary storage before the days of hard disk drives. Data read/write speed is slower due to sequential access.

  5. RAID
    There are five RAID levels, each optimized for a specific situation. All RAID levels except RAID 0 offer protection against single drive failures.

  8. Swap-Space Management in Operating system
    The area on the disk where swap processes are stored is called swap space. Swap-Space Management is one of the low-level tasks of the operating system that uses up disk space, so it will significantly reduce system performance because disk access is much slower than memory access. The page also provides a description of swap-space locations and examples.

  9. Apa itu Penyimpanan Massal (Mass Storage Device)?
    A Mass Storage Device (MSD) is any storage device that makes it possible to store and port large amounts of data across computers, servers, and in an IT environment. Mass Storage refers to the various techniques and devices for storing large amounts of data. This page also provides an explanation of the types of MSD.
